Jim is a faith based progressive community activist and writer in Michigan's Upper Peninsula. He is a trustee on a multi-county Behavioral Health Board and a received the Governor's appointment for the Dept. of Human Services Board in Mackinac County. Jim is a trustee on the local church sponsored food pantry, getting food to Michigan's needy.
Jim is a graduate of the Michigan Progressive Leadership Fellowship . Jim formerly blogged on"Crossleft.org ", a progressive Christian website. Jim takes his spirituality seriously and is a Presbyterian Elder, a Lay Pastor Candidate, substitute minister,and is affiliated with the Progressive Christian Alliance. Jim's political ideas come from a deep rooted spirituality that emphasizes love of God and neighbor. Jim often writes on matters of a spiritual or religious nature.
Jim also writes on matters of concern to veterans and is a member of Veterans for Peace and a Vietnam veteran. He has helped many veterans access the V.A. health care system and has helped some disabled veterans get much deserved benefits from the V.A.
Jim recently started a non-profit "Up North Ministries" to try help fellow Michiganders during this horrible time of unemployment, hunger, and homelessness.
